Faulty Lodge Couch- Unhappy customer

Workmanship and Quality of my brand new Lodge Leather couch is unacceptable. My after sales experience has also been dismal. I've complained directly to the sales person and written a complaint just 4 days after receiving my couch, which already has sinking seats and certain parts of the couch have been wrapped in a variation of old worn looking leather, its like they mixed in segments with the new leather they show you instore. The sales person rather blatantly said I cannot get a refund even after i sent her photos.

I am mortified that this item has been QC passed and for the price paid, it is alarming to already see such flaws surface. Whats more disappointing, is that no response has yet been received from the Coricraft group. Consumers should be wary of the quality when buying a Coricraft product. I have been supp**** a Faulty item and I believe that I should be fully refunded. How much worse will the sinking seats get within a month I'm afraid to find out.

We are so sorry that you are disappointed with your new couch. We have booked an assessment to ensure that the couch meets our specifications.

Regarding the concerns you've raised, we want to clarify that the foam used in our couches can initially feel firm but will soften up to 30% within the first three months of use. This is a normal process, and the foam will stabilize at that softness thereafter.

Additionally, the leather you purchased is an aniline leather, which means it retains all the natural characteristics of the animals it was sourced from. This includes wrinkles, scars, and colour variations, which are inherent to aniline leather and are part of its unique charm and beauty.
